Worker’s Choice Act

Bill name: Worker’s Choice Act
Bill sponsor: H.R. 5147, Rep. Dusty Johnson (R-SD)

Bill Summary: The Worker’s Choice Act would allow employees the option to opt out of union representation and negotiate employment terms individually with their employer. The bill amends the National Labor Relations Act (NLRA) and eliminates the requirement for employees to pay dues or fees to a labor union as a condition of employment.

In effect, the Worker’s Choice Act would solve the following:

  • the “forced rider” issue – when an employee is forced to work under terms negotiated by a union, even though the worker may not be a member of the union
  • the “free rider” claim – where a union is required by exclusive representation to negotiate on behalf of a worker that has opted out of a union via a state’s Right to Work law

 

Bill Status:  Reps. Dusty Johnson (R-SD), Greg Murphy (R-NC), and Phil Roe (R-TN) introduced the Worker’s Choice Act on November 18, 2019. It has been referred to the House Committee on Education and Labor, though no legislative action has occurred.
